In 2004, Jeanette Hedström experienced a horrific car crashthat she claims catapulted her out of her body as angels revealed to her the "other side" and offered her a choice about whether toreturn to Earth after showing her two potential futures. Speaking to NeedtoKnow, the retreat leader shared: "I had to explore my future as the angels predicted; so I made the decision to return."
The Swedish native and her stepsister were on a road trip when a truck abruptly switched lanes, pushing them into oncoming traffic where they crashed head-on with another vehicle. Jeanette's seatbelt forced her internal organs up under her heart, causing her diaphragm to rupture, tearing her intestines and puncturing her lungs.
Jeanette wasn't immediately transported to the 'waiting room', as she remembered feeling all of her injuries in the aftermath: "I couldn't breathe and everything hurt. I kept yelling: 'I'm dying' over and over. All I wanted was to go home – and then I left my body.

"I saw everything unfold, like a film scene, where I couldn't even comprehend that my physical form was still in the car and I was just a soul floating above."
She could still sense her body struggling to survive when a voice told her to "let go" and she was whisked away. The waiting room she ended up in felt like she had returned home with "such a deep sense of belonging" that she instantly decided to stay.
There, she encountered three spiritual presences; her deceased godmother and two angels. They revealed to her "the energies" of the man she would eventually wed and three future children waiting for her should she choose to return. They also showed her how the world would continue if she chose to stay in the afterlife.
The 42-year-old said: "The angels showed me how important it was for life to carry on. The voices of everyone on Earth praying for me – my friends, mother, father and sister – all asking me to survive and fight played in my ears. I knew I couldn't let them down."
When Jeanette regained consciousness in hospital, her body had been undergoing life-saving emergency operations for three days. Each organ in her abdomen required removal and replacement after fluid was administered to relieve the pressure.
She remained on a ventilator for days whilst her eyelids were surgically repaired, a titanium rod was inserted into her arm and three vertebrae were fused in her spine. Medical staff remained uncertain whether she would regain the ability to walk or face a lifetime of chronic pain.
However, just weeks following the crash, Jeanette had recovered. She remarked: "The speed at which I recovered was beyond explanation."

She suffers no permanent complications from the accident, and the visions from her near-death experience have proven to be true according to the retreat leader. She said: "It turned out to be the right man, the one I knew deep within I was meant to meet.
"Today, we have two beautiful children – but one is missing. I lost a son in pregnancy, and maybe he was the third one I felt; or maybe there's still a surprise waiting for us."
Jeanette reckons her brush with death stands as one of the most profound and precious lessons she's ever encountered, as it destroyed her "false self" and redirected her soul's journey in this existence. She believes the waiting area she was transported to served as a gateway where her spirit was destined to be reborn.
She continued: "I carry a completely different relationship to life now. I want to live, and I know it's important that I'm here. I wouldn't want to go back to how things were before – I'm no longer living out of fear, but out of love and courage.
"Death isn't something I'm afraid of anymore because I know what's waiting for me on the other side. When my time comes, it comes."
